What is this place?:

Hindu Temple – This is a revered Hindu temple dedicated to Lord Balarama, often known regionally as Laburam Ji. It stands as a significant spiritual site within the scenic region of Kashmir .

Why people come here:

Devotion & Blessings – People primarily visit this temple for spiritual devotion, to offer prayers, and seek blessings from Lord Balarama. It serves as a place for traditional Hindu rituals and ceremonies.

Spiritual or cultural significance:

Ancient Roots – The temple holds deep spiritual and cultural importance, representing a historical continuity of Hindu faith and traditions in Kashmir . For many, it is a connection to ancient religious heritage.

What to expect:

Peaceful Atmosphere – I expect you'll find a serene and devout atmosphere here, conducive to prayer and reflection. The experience typically involves observing traditional Hindu customs and soaking in the spiritual ambiance.

Visitor etiquette:

Respectful Conduct – To show respect, I recommend dressing modestly, covering shoulders and knees. It's customary to remove your footwear before entering the main temple area. Maintaining a calm and quiet demeanor is also appreciated. Photography rules may vary, especially within the inner sanctum.
